Deploy Profile to Cluster

Enable Profile Agent on Cluster

Before you can deploy a PMK RBAC profile on to a cluster, you need to enable the PMK profile agent for that cluster. You can do this when creating a new cluster by including the Profile Agent in the cluster creation wizard. Use the advanced cluster creation wizard in the PMK UI, select your Kubernetes version to be 1.21 or higher, and the Profile engine option will become visible to you in the wizard under Application & Container Settings. Check the box next to that option to enable that feature.

Deploy a Profile to a Cluster

In the RBAC Profile tab, users can deploy a profile by clicking on the radio button to select the specific profile name, then click on the Deploy button. This opens a new window where we can review the profile summary, the name of the cluster it will be applied to, and the number of roles that will be applied. Next, select the cluster to apply the profile to. And finally, click the Deploy button again to implement the change.

Note that we can also click on Show Impact Analysis button to show what effect the change will have.

RBAC profiles can only be deployed onto clusters with Kubernetes version 1.21 and newer that have Profile Agent installed.
